Bed Bug Eggs In Hair Dryer. That heat level can kill bed bugs, but only if you maintain the heat over them for several minutes. First, bed bugs that are exposed to 113°f will die if the heat can maintain for more than 90 minutes. The heat will kill all eggs, nymphs, and adults.
